Two young men died in a road accident early Monday in North 24 Parganas’ Madhyamgram. The incident took place around dawn on Kazi Nazrul Islam Sarani, when a high-speed fish-laden pickup van collided with a motorcycle. The collision resulted in the death of 25-year-old S.K. Kasid on the spot. The other rider, Ziarul Rahman, was seriously injured and admitted to a private hospital, where he later died during treatment.
Following the accident, the pickup van overturned due to the impact. The driver and helper of the vehicle fled the scene, leaving the van behind. As news of the accident spread, tension escalated in the area. Locals gathered in large numbers and blocked the Jessore Road, disrupting vehicular movement. Protesters also vandalised a nearby traffic police booth during the agitation.
With the situation worsening, a large police force from Barasat Police District, along with senior officers, arrived at the location. Authorities managed to control the crowd and clear the blockade after several hours. Police have registered a case and initiated an investigation to identify and locate the absconding driver and his assistant.
